Tibetian Lama by Nicholas Roerich: A Himalayan Vision of Spiritual Contemplation

The painting “Tibetian Lama” by Nicholas Roerich stands as an arresting testament to the artist’s profound engagement with Eastern mysticism and his unwavering pursuit of spiritual enlightenment. Executed in 1927, during a period marked by Roerich's extensive travels across Asia – particularly Tibet – this artwork embodies the serene grandeur of the Himalayan landscape interwoven with symbolic representations of Buddhist philosophy. It resides within the Symbolism movement, reflecting a stylistic preference for evocative imagery and emotional resonance rather than strict realism.
  • Style: Symbolism – Characterized by dreamlike qualities and an emphasis on conveying spiritual ideas through visual metaphors.
  • Technique: Oil paint on canvas – Roerich employed meticulous brushwork to capture the textures of stone, snow, and robe fabric, achieving remarkable luminosity and depth.
The composition centers around a solitary Tibetan lama seated in meditative posture amidst towering Himalayan peaks. The lama’s yellow robe, a color traditionally associated with royalty and enlightenment in Buddhism, dominates the visual field, symbolizing spiritual authority and devotion. Surrounding him are stylized mountains – not merely geological formations but representations of inner landscapes mirroring the lama's quest for transcendence. Prayer flags fluttering in the wind add to the atmosphere, conveying mantras and blessings—a tangible manifestation of faith and aspiration. Historical Context: Roerich’s journey to Tibet coincided with a burgeoning interest in Eastern spirituality within Western intellectual circles. He sought inspiration from Buddhist teachings and incorporated them into his artistic vision, reflecting a broader cultural dialogue between East and West during the interwar years. His work aligns with the Zeitgeist of a time yearning for solace amidst societal upheaval—a desire for beauty and contemplation as pathways to spiritual understanding. Symbolism & Spiritual Significance: Beyond its aesthetic appeal, “Tibetian Lama” is laden with symbolic meaning. The lama’s downward gaze signifies introspection and detachment from worldly concerns – the core tenets of Buddhist meditation. The mountains represent stability, permanence, and the vastness of cosmic consciousness. Roerich's masterful use of color—primarily blues and greens mirroring the Himalayan environment—creates a palpable sense of tranquility and invites viewers to contemplate profound questions about existence and purpose.

Ultimately, “Tibetian Lama” transcends mere depiction; it aspires to evoke an emotional response – fostering contemplation and reminding us of the enduring power of spiritual aspiration. It’s a captivating piece that continues to inspire admiration for its artistic merit and its profound connection to Eastern philosophical traditions.
